How Much Does It Cost to Finish a Basement?

Let’s talk numbers. Because everyone wonders — “How much will it cost me?”

Average Range

Most homeowners spend between $25,000 and $75,000, depending on design, space, and materials. Sounds like a lot? Maybe. But think of it this way — you’re adding usable square footage, boosting property value, and gaining a whole new living area.

What Affects the Price

  • Size matters. Bigger basements mean more framing, flooring, and time.

  • Design choices. Wet bars, bathrooms, and built-ins raise the total.

  • Permits and codes. They’re necessary, and they vary by city.

  • Moisture control. A big deal for basements. Skip it, and you’ll regret it later.

How to Choose the Right Contractor

Choosing who to trust with your basement is a big decision. Don’t rush it.

Experience First

Ask how long they’ve been in business. Check past projects. Read reviews. The more they’ve done, the better they’ll handle challenges.

Ask for Proof

Licenses, insurance, certifications — make sure they’re legit. This protects you and your investment.

Portfolio Matters

FAQs

1. How long does finishing a basement take?
Typically 4–8 weeks, depending on the design and approvals.

2. Do I really need permits?
Yep. Every proper Basement finishing contractor knows which permits are required — and handles them for you.

3. What’s the best flooring for a basement?
Go with vinyl plank or engineered wood. They handle moisture like pros.

4. Can I design the space myself?
Sure! Bring your ideas — your contractor can help shape them into something buildable and stylish.

5. How do I keep it dry?
Moisture control and insulation are key. A professional will make sure that’s handled from day one.
